The 2024 CAF Awards ceremony, held in Marrakech, Morocco, was a night to remember, as African football’s finest were honored for their outstanding achievements.
Nigeria’s Ademola Lookman took center stage, claiming the prestigious Men’s Player of the Year award. Lookman’s impressive performances for both club and country made him a standout candidate for the honor.
Chiamaka Nnadozie also made Nigeria proud, retaining her title as Women’s Goalkeeper of the Year. The Super Falcons, Nigeria’s national women’s football team, were crowned Women’s National Team of the Year for a record sixth time.
2024 CAF Awards: Complete list of winners:
Individual Awards
– Men’s Player of the Year: Ademola Lookman (Nigeria)
– Women’s Player of the Year: Barbra Banda (Zambia)
– Men’s Coach of the Year: Emerse Faé (Côte d’Ivoire)
– Women’s Coach of the Year: Lamia Boumehdi (TP Mazembe; Morocco)
– Men’s Goalkeeper of the Year: Ronwen Williams (South Africa)
– Women’s Goalkeeper of the Year: Chiamaka Nnadozie (Nigeria)
– Men’s Young Player of the Year: Lamine Camara (Senegal)
– Women’s Young Player of the Year: Doha El Madani (AS FAR; Morocco)
– Men’s Interclub Player of the Year: Ronwen Williams (Mamelodi Sundowns; South Africa)
– Women’s Interclub Player of the Year: Sanâa Mssoudy (AS FAR; Morocco)
Team Awards
– Men’s National Team of the Year: Côte d’Ivoire
– Women’s National Team of the Year: Super Falcons of Nigeria
– Men’s Club of the Year: Al Ahly (Egypt)
– Women’s Club of the Year: TP Mazembe (DR Congo)
Special Awards
– Goal of the Year: Mabululu (Goal for Angola against Namibia)
– Best Referee (Women): Bouchra Karboubi (Morocco)
– Best Referee (Men): Elvis Guy Nguegoue (Cameroon)
